| #pragma once |
| |
| #include <cstdint> |
| #include <vector> |
| #include <string> |
| |
| namespace test_vendor_lib { |
| |
| // Encapsulate handling for Bluetooth Addresses: |
| // - store the address |
| // - convert to/from strings and vectors of bytes |
| // - check strings to see if they represent a valid address |
| class BtAddress { |
| public: |
| // Conversion constants |
| static const size_t kStringLength = 17; // "XX:XX:XX:XX:XX:XX" |
| static const size_t kOctets = 6; // "X0:X1:X2:X3:X4:X5" |
| |
| BtAddress() : address_(0){}; |
| virtual ~BtAddress() = default; |
| |
| // Returns true if |addr| has the form "XX:XX:XX:XX:XX:XX": |
| // - the length of |addr| is >= kStringLength |
| // - every third character is ':' |
| // - each remaining character is a hexadecimal digit |
| static bool IsValid(const std::string& addr); |
| |
| inline bool operator==(const BtAddress& right) { |
| return address_ == right.address_; |
| } |
| inline bool operator!=(const BtAddress& right) { |
| return address_ != right.address_; |
| } |
| inline bool operator<(const BtAddress& right) { |
| return address_ < right.address_; |
| } |
| inline bool operator>(const BtAddress& right) { |
| return address_ > right.address_; |
| } |
| inline bool operator<=(const BtAddress& right) { |
| return address_ <= right.address_; |
| } |
| inline bool operator>=(const BtAddress& right) { |
| return address_ >= right.address_; |
| } |
| |
| inline void operator=(const BtAddress& right) { address_ = right.address_; } |
| inline void operator|=(const BtAddress& right) { address_ |= right.address_; } |
| inline void operator&=(const BtAddress& right) { address_ &= right.address_; } |
| |
| // Set the address to the address represented by |str|. |
| // returns true if |str| represents a valid address, otherwise false. |
| bool FromString(const std::string& str); |
| |
| // Set the address to the address represented by |str|. |
| // returns true if octets.size() >= kOctets, otherwise false. |
| bool FromVector(const std::vector<uint8_t>& octets); |
| |
| // Appends the Bluetooth address to the vector |octets|. |
| void ToVector(std::vector<uint8_t>& octets) const; |
| |
| // Return a string representation of the Bluetooth address, in this format: |
| // "xx:xx:xx:xx:xx:xx", where x represents a lowercase hexadecimal digit. |
| std::string ToString() const; |
| |
| private: |
| // The Bluetooth Address is stored in the lower 48 bits of a 64-bit value |
| uint64_t address_; |
| }; |
| |
| } // namespace test_vendor_lib |
